On Fri, Jul 27, 2012 at 11:39 AM, Kenny Noe <knoe...@gmail.com> wrote: > John, > > Thanks for the reply. I have "inherited" this instance from a former > employee and am trying to get up to speed. > > When I go to the console to perform an "update pool" I'm prompted to choose > a resource. So I have to go to each resource and update the pools. That > makes sense. But when I go and "update all volumes" I get 4 choices. I'm > assuming I pick #2 "Pool from resource" and then choose the pool to update. > And then do this for each pool. Is this correct? > I am sorry. I was going from memory. You want to do this first: *update Update choice: 1: Volume parameters 2: Pool from resource 3: Slots from autochanger 4: Long term statistics Choose catalog item to update (1-4):2 then follow the prompts. Then do the following: *update Automatically selected Catalog: HBCatalog Using Catalog "HBCatalog" Update choice: 1: Volume parameters 2: Pool from resource 3: Slots from autochanger 4: Long term statistics Choose catalog item to update (1-4): 1 Parameters to modify: 1: Volume Status 2: Volume Retention Period 3: Volume Use Duration 4: Maximum Volume Jobs 5: Maximum Volume Files 6: Maximum Volume Bytes 7: Recycle Flag 8: Slot 9: InChanger Flag 10: Volume Files 11: Pool 12: Volume from Pool 13: All Volumes from Pool 14: All Volumes from all Pools 15: Enabled 16: RecyclePool 17: Action On Purge 18: Done Select parameter to modify (1-18):13 and follow the prompts.
